The Copenhagen-based Global Maritime Forum (GMF) has completed a study that concludes ammonia-powered gas carriers could compete effectively as soon as 2026. The findings are based on a route from the US Gulf Coast to northwestern Europe. The route has … Continue reading →

Bureau Veritas (BV) has produced a feasibility study to estimate the usefulness of carbon capture from marine engines. BV is a multinational risk management insurer and classification society with a strong maritime profile. The study was conducted by QIYAO EnvironTech … Continue reading →

A new study published by the Institute of Physics shows that green ammonia could fuel 60% of shipping worldwide. Is green ammonia the answer for the shipping industry?
Initial results from the study show that parametric rolling in following seas is especially hazardous for container vessels, a phenomenon that is not well known and can develop unexpectedly with severe consequences giving rise to several maritime disasters. The Spanish automotive manufacturers’ association, Anfac, has just released its annual Maritime Port Logistics Grading study, which identifies Santander (pictured), Sagunto and Pasajes ports as currently the best for vehicle processing in Spain. One aspect the study identified as being key was good road access to ports.
Studies by Simpson, Spence and Young, a leading global shipbroking firm, seem to indicate that emission benefits of slow-steaming have been exaggerated. One reason offered is that the ‘cubic law’, which says that fuel consumption rises as the cube of … Continue reading →
